No Problem, Bill. It looks like Firefox 2.x will be getting updates until
about the end of 2008 and then 98(SE) users will be left with using an unsupported Firefox version, swtiching to Opera, using an old Internet Explorer version officially unsupported since July 11, 2006. However, there were some workarounds as to breaking Internet Explorer patches to use the updated components for Internet Explorer 6 sp1 in 98SE and I even tried this for a little while but it probably is not worth the time and effort and potential dll problems. It really looks like the time is fast approaching when the remaining 98(SE) on the Internet will continue to grow smaller and smaller. Windows 98 really did have a good run and it is hard to believe that it is a decade old and next year will be the 10 year anniversary for Windows 98 Second Edition. "Bill Watt" wrote: Reply at end.
